yummy baked oatmeal

prep time
10 Min
cook time
30 Min
method
Bake
yield
4 to 6
Ingredients
- 3 cups oatmeal, uncooked
- 1 cup brown sugar/brown sugar splenda
- 1 1/2 teaspoons cinnamon
- 2 teaspoons baking powder
- 1 stick butter
- 1 cup milk
- 1 teaspoon vanilla
- 2 large eggs beaten
How To Make yummy baked oatmeal
-
Step 1Preheat oven to 350, place 8x8 or 9x9 baking pan in oven with butter to melt butter. Keep an eye on the butter as not to burn it.
-
Step 2Mix all dry ingredients in large bowl.
-
Step 3Mix eggs, milk, vanilla and stir into dry ingredients.
-
Step 4Remove pan with melted butter from oven and place oatmeal mixture into baking pan and mix to incorporate butter but leaving some butter on the side's of pan
-
Step 5Bake for 30 minutes
-
Step 6Serve warm with warm milk or cream and fruit of your choice.
